The Changing Face of Cybercrime
The Early Days: Basic Attacks and Viruses
In the late 20th century, cyber threats were largely rudimentary, characterized by viruses, worms, and simple attacks aimed at causing mischief or stealing basic information. Many early hackers operated on the fringes of ethical behavior, motivated by curiosity or the challenge of bypassing systems for personal satisfaction. These initial threats often required minimal sophistication, relying on social engineering and simple malware to exploit unsuspecting users.
The Rise of Organized Cybercrime
As technology advanced, so too did the professionalism of cybercriminals. The advent of the internet and the proliferation of online services led to the rise of organized cybercrime. Dealing in large-scale theft, these groups operated like businesses, often collaborating globally to maximize their impact. This marked a significant shift from individual hackers to organized groups utilizing advanced techniques to extract financial information, conduct identity theft, and launch distributed denial-of-service (DDoS) attacks.
- Ransomware: One of the most notable developments has been the emergence of ransomware, a type of malware that encrypts a victim’s files, demanding payment for decryption. The success of high-profile attacks, such as WannaCry and REvil, has spurred a ransomware boom, wherein attackers target critical infrastructure and healthcare organizations, often leading to catastrophic outcomes if the victims do not comply.
The Sophistication of Offenses: Advanced Persistent Threats (APTs)
As cyber defenses improved, hackers adapted by employing more sophisticated tactics. Advanced Persistent Threats (APTs) represent one of the most concerning evolutions in cybercrime. APTs involve prolonged and targeted attacks by well-funded and organized groups, often state-sponsored, designed to infiltrate networks stealthily and maintain access over extended periods to gather sensitive information.
- Supply Chain Attacks: One of the most effective means of engaging in APT is through supply chain attacks, where hackers compromise a third-party vendor to gain access to larger networks. The SolarWinds attack in 2020 is a striking example, wherein attackers manipulated software updates to infiltrate the networks of thousands of organizations, including several U.S. government agencies.
Refining Techniques: AI and Machine Learning in Cyber Threats
The rise of artificial intelligence (AI) and machine learning (ML) has also impacted cyber threats. Hackers are now leveraging these technologies to refine their techniques further. AI can facilitate the development of more sophisticated attack vectors, automate tasks, and analyze large datasets for vulnerabilities.
- Phishing Scams: Phishing attacks have become increasingly sophisticated, with hackers employing machine learning to craft highly personalized messages that bypass traditional detection measures. By analyzing user data, hackers can impersonate someone the victim knows and trusts, making it significantly harder for individuals to recognize the threat.
The New Frontier: Zero-Day Exploits and Cloud Vulnerabilities
Another worrisome adaptation is the increasing prevalence of zero-day vulnerabilities—previously unknown bugs in software or hardware that attackers exploit before developers can issue patches. As more businesses migrate to cloud-based solutions, these vulnerabilities have become a prime target for cybercriminals.
- Cloud Security Risks: With the digital transformation accelerating, misconfigured cloud settings and inadequate security protocols have also emerged as significant vulnerabilities. Hackers exploit these weaknesses to gain unauthorized access to organizations’ sensitive data, often leading to massive data breaches.
The Role of Legislation and Public Awareness
As the tactics of cybercriminals evolve, so too must the approaches of governments and organizations. Legislative measures like the General Data Protection Regulation (GDPR) in Europe and the California Consumer Privacy Act (CCPA) are designed to impose stricter data protection requirements and hold organizations accountable for breaches.
Furthermore, public awareness and education are increasingly critical in defending against cyber threats. Organizations must foster a culture of cybersecurity awareness among employees to detect and respond to threats effectively. Training and simulations can play a pivotal role in preparing staff to recognize phishing attempts and other social engineering tactics.
